#1eecc2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1eecc2 is composed of 11.8% red, 92.5%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 17.8%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 167.8 degrees, a saturation of 84.4% and a lightness of 52.2%. #1eecc2 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cffff with #00d985. Closest websafe color is: #33ffcc.

Shades and Tints of #1eecc2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010a08 is the darkest color, while #f7fef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1eecc2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c8e8a is the less saturated color, while #0bffcd is the most saturated one.
